Deutsche Bahn

About
Deutsche Bahn (DB) is Germany’s main train operator, running around 40,000 domestic and international services each day. Its fleet includes a variety of train types: high-speed ICE (Intercity Express) trains, reaching up to 300 km/h; IC (Intercity) and EC (EuroCity) trains for long-distance travel; and IRE (Interregio-Express), RE (Regional Express), and RB (Regionalbahn) services for regional and local connections. While bathrooms are standard on all trains, amenities such as onboard restaurants and free Wi-Fi are available only on certain train types and routes. DB offers a wide range of fares, including Super Saver, Saver, and Flexible tickets, along with discount cards like the BahnCard 25, 50, and 100. Additional options include single tickets, day tickets, and group tickets. Popular routes include Berlin–Munich, Hamburg–Frankfurt, Cologne–Stuttgart, Berlin–Dresden, and Hamburg–Cologne, as well as numerous regional services across Germany.

EuroCity

About
EuroCity (EC) is an international train category and brand for inter-city trains that cross international borders within Europe. These trains are a collaboration between various European rail companies, including Deutsche Bahn (Germany), Trenitalia (Italy), SBB (Switzerland), and ÖBB (Austria). EuroCity trains connect major cities across Europe, offering both first and second-class coaches. They are known for meeting specific criteria for comfort, speed, cleanliness, and onboard food service, including air-conditioned cars and dining facilities. EuroCity services aim to provide convenient and comfortable cross-border travel, with stops typically lasting no more than 5 to 15 minutes.

In Utrecht, explore the unique two-level canals with wharf cellars and vibrant cafés. Visit Museum Speelklok to discover self-playing musical instruments and clocks. Experience the history of Dutch railways at the Railway Museum with interactive exhibits. Enjoy diverse performances at the modern music complex, TivoliVredenburg. Relax in Griftpark, featuring playgrounds, a petting zoo, and a café. Don't miss the Dom Tower for panoramic city views, the serene Utrecht University Botanic Gardens, and religious art at Museum Catharijneconvent. Admire the Rietveld Schröder House,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and stroll along the picturesque Oudegracht canal.
Visitors typically spend 2 to 3 days in Utrecht to explore its historic city centre, museums, and unique attractions like the Dom Tower and the canals.
